The Basics

Score: Roanoke 80, Ferrum 67
Records: Roanoke 11-4 / 5-1 ODAC | Ferrum 7-8 / 2-4 ODAC
Location: Ferrum, Va.    

The Lead: Four players scored in double-figures as Roanoke ran its win streak to seven games with an 80-67 victory over Ferrum on Wednesday.

How it Happened

  • Ferrum led a tightly contested first-half 21-18 with 11 minutes to go before RC went on a 12-2 run that was capped by an Ethan Rohan free-throw that made the score 30-23 with 3:37 to play.
  • The Maroons extended their lead to nine points following a Rohan put back of a Tripp Greene shot that put RC up 34-25 with under two minutes to go.
  • A Caleb Jordan bucket in the final five seconds of the half sent Roanoke to the locker room leading 38-31.
  • Three-point baskets by Kasey Draper and Dillon Thomas in the first minute of the second-half pushed the RC advantage to 44-31.
  • A Greene three-pointer at the 11:35 mark gave RC an 18-point lead at 56-38.
  • With the score 65-55, Ferrum would score seven straight points, cutting the RC lead to 65-62 after a pair of free-throws from Caleb McReed with 4:31 left on the clock.
  • RC scored the next 12 points with a Draper free-throw making it 77-62 with 1:20 to play in the game.
  • Jordan led RC with 16 points. Greene and Joe Mikalauskas each had 14 points, while Draper chipped in with 11. Rohan had nine rebounds to help RC to a 33-32 edge on the glass.
  • Roanoke made 25-of-53 (47.2%) shots from the floor, including 12 three-pointers.
  • McReed and Rashad Reed each had 16 points for Ferrum. Carrington Young grabbed a game-high 12 rebounds for the Panthers.
